1992 Suzuki Vitara receiver-drier — what it does and when to replace it

Based on technical sources, the 1992 Suzuki Vitara does use a separate receiver‑drier in its air‑conditioning system. The Suzuki factory service manual for Vitara/Sidekick (1989–1998, Heating & Air Conditioning section) illustrates a TXV-style A/C circuit with a receiver‑drier located in the high‑pressure liquid line near the condenser, and the Suzuki Electronic Parts Catalogue for this model year lists a dedicated receiver/drier assembly (including a port for the pressure switch). Major aftermarket catalogues (e.g., Four Seasons, DENSO, Ryco/Repco listings) also specify a replacement receiver‑drier for 1992 Vitara, confirming fitment.

On the 1992 Vitara, the receiver‑drier is the A/C system’s moisture and debris bouncer at the door. It sits in the liquid line after the condenser, storing a small charge of refrigerant, filtering out fine rubbish, and drying the system via a desiccant pack. That’s critical for an older R‑12 design (and for many that have been retrofitted to R‑134a), because moisture and acid inside the system will chew out components, turn oil milky, and freeze at the expansion valve — all of which kill cooling performance.

As part of routine servicing, the receiver‑drier should be replaced any time the system is opened to atmosphere — like when changing a compressor, condenser, or hoses — or if the car has lost gas. On a 1992 vehicle, the desiccant is well past its prime if it’s original. If the system’s being re‑gassed after years off the road, fitting a new drier is cheap insurance.

  • Typical interval: replace whenever the circuit is opened, after a major leak, or during R‑134a retrofit. Many techs also swap it preventatively every 3–5 years in harsh climates.
  • Symptoms of trouble: poor cooling at idle, frosting at the TXV, high high‑side pressure, or metallic debris found in oil — all justify replacement.
  • Best practice on fitment: use new HNBR O‑rings, add the correct compressor oil type and quantity for the drier, and evacuate the system to deep vacuum before re‑gassing. Never vent refrigerant, in AU/NZ, ensure work is carried out by a licensed A/C technician (ARCtick in Australia).
  • Location: typically up front near the condenser, a small canister with two line fittings and often a pressure switch port.

Treat the receiver‑drier as a service item, not a lifetime part. Keeping it fresh protects the TXV and compressor, keeps moisture at bay, and helps the old Vitara blow nice and cold on stinking‑hot days.

FAQs

Where is the receiver‑drier on a 1992 Vitara?
It’s usually mounted near the condenser at the front of the vehicle, on the passenger side on many RHD models. Look for a slim metal canister in the high‑pressure line, often with a pressure switch screwed into a port. Access is generally from under the bonnet, the front grille or splash shields may need to come off for room.

How often should it be replaced?
Replace it any time the A/C system is opened, after a major leak, or when retrofitting from R‑12 to R‑134a. If the system has been idle for years, fit a new unit before re‑gassing. As a preventative, many workshops in Australia and New Zealand will change it every few years to keep moisture and debris in check.

Can a blocked receiver‑drier damage the A/C?
Yes. A restricted drier starves the TXV of liquid refrigerant, causing poor cooling and odd pressure readings. Prolonged restriction can overwork the compressor and contaminate the circuit. If pressures or performance suggest a restriction, replacing the drier and flushing the system is the sensible move.
